Medicare experts to meet

Advertisement

BRIDGTON — Three of Maine’s top Medicare experts will meet for a forum on Medicare from 1:30 to 3:30 p.m. Wednesday, Aug. 29, at the Bridgton Community Center.

The panel consists of Stan Cohen, a well-known Medicare advocate and volunteer with Southern Maine Agency on Aging; Anne Smith, Medicare Rights Advocate of Legal Services for the Elderly; and Gordon Smith, executive vice president of Maine Medical Association.

Lisa Villa, who assembled the panel, said, “The purpose of the forum is to inform seniors of the new Medicare preventative benefits, the Wellness Visit, Medicare provisions in the Affordable Care Act and to carefully explain how the ACA will impact them.”

The forum will be taped by Lake Region TV and it will be distributed to community television stations throughout the state. For more information contact Lisa Villa at 776-3118.
